Facts and Events
Name Nathaniel Reynolds
Gender Male
Birth[1] 14 Jan 1693/94 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United States
Christening[2] 21 Jan 1693/94 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United States
Marriage 27 Jan 1716/17 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United Statesto Mary Snell
Death[3][4] 29 Oct 1719 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United States
References
  1.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United States. Births, Baptisms, Marriages, and Deaths, 1630-1699 (A Report of the Record Commissioners): Document 130. (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ts, United States: Rockwell and Churchill, City Printers, 1883)
    p. 208.

    1693. Town.
    Nathll. of Nathll. & Ruth Raynolds born Jan. 14.
    [1693/94 based on date of baptism.]

  2. "Records of the First Church in Boston", in Dunkle, Robert J., and Ann S. Lainhart. Records of the Churches of Boston and the First Church, Second Parish, and Third Parish of Roxbury: including baptisms, marriages, deaths, admissions, and dismissals: (1600s-1800s). (Boston, MA: New England Historic Genealogical Society, 2001)
    p. 252.

    Jan. 21, 1693/4 ... Nathaniell Reynolds [baptized].
    [Also reported in Boston Births, p. 220, under heading "1694. First Church". But this source is transcribed in original order so easier to determine true meaning of date, and the compiler was able to indicate the correct double-dating.]

  3. Dunkle, Robert J., and Ann S. (Ann Smith) Lainhart. Deaths in Boston 1700 to 1799. (Boston, Massachusetts: New England Historic Genealogical Society, c1999).

    Nathaniel Renalds, 26 Oct 1719, 26 y.
    [Source indicated as Holbrook Fiche. Also found in small manuscript of deaths kept by unknown author. Birth about 1693.]

  4. Reynolds Family Association annual report
    p. 259.

    Will of "Nathaniel Raynolds of Boston ... being sick and weak of Body", dated 16 Oct 1719, probated 23 Nov 1719, names "my two children" [under age], "my loving wife Mary Reynolds" [sole Executrix].
